If you are considering doing F# compilation on the client in JavaScript, good luck ;) You may want to look at CloudSharper, which implements an F# web IDE with F# Interactive and full code assistance, but it requires a local server component to work with the web interface. So essentially, there is no "remote server" to do the job, but it is nonetheless a server running on your own machine.

Now, CloudSharper can soon alleviate the need for you to run the local server and instead provide that in a cloud-hosted infrastructure, but this is an upcoming feature and will be premium.
